Crayford station is well-equipped with a variety of facilities to cater to your travel needs. The ticket office is open from early in the morning until late in the evening, and there are also ticket machines available for your convenience. If you've purchased tickets online, you can collect them easily from the station's ticket machines. The station is accessibility-friendly, with step-free access to platforms and accessible ticket machines located on the forecourt.
While the station lacks a waiting room, it does offer seating areas for relaxation while you wait for your train. There are accessible toilets available, although there are no baby changing facilities. Security is a priority, with CCTV cameras in place throughout the station and car park.
Crayford station provides some refreshment options to keep you fueled for your journey. You can grab a hot cup of coffee from the coffee kiosk or pick up snacks from the Selecta vending machine. Newspaper stalls are also present for a quick read during your wait. Although there's no ATM or currency exchange here, you can enjoy a fresh brew as you plan your trip.
Getting assistance at Crayford is straightforward and tailored to passengers with different needs. Step-free access is available, albeit with some limitations between platforms. There's also a ramp for train access, and staff help is generally available across the week during specific hours. For more extensive needs, a mobile assistance team can be reached through the customer services helpline or at help points located around the station.

Botley Station, although modest in size, provides essential amenities for travelers. While there is no manned ticket office, you can easily collect any pre-booked tickets via one of the ticket machines available on-site. These machines accommodate purchases for those with Disabled Persons Railcard discounts, ensuring inclusivity. An induction loop is available to assist those with hearing impairments.
Despite the absence of waiting rooms or refreshment facilities, free parking is abundantly available. If you're traveling by bicycle, four storage racks are provided, with CCTV monitoring in place for added security. However, it's important to note the lack of accessible taxis and step-free access, which may require advance planning for those with reduced mobility.
Continuing your journey beyond Botley is straightforward. The station is connected by regular bus services, with a bus stop conveniently located near the Railway Inn Pub. Here, travelers can catch buses to Eastleigh and Fareham. The printable bus information ensures a seamless transfer from rail to road, aiding in travel planning.
For those times when rail services are disrupted, alternative transport options are offered with a rail replacement bus service available at designated stops. While car hire services aren't directly available at the station, taxi services remain a viable alternative for quicker travels or when you're laden with luggage.
